A fun ride! Went with my wife yesterday and we had such a good time. The volunteers put in so much of their time and make it such an enjoyable experience. Everyone is kind and really cares about the train preservation. The one con is that the train ride is a bit short. I did a bit of research online and saw that the train rode all the way to New Freedom until the early 2000’s when there was a derailment. They told us yesterday that they are trying to fix the tracks to get the train running to New Freedom again, but that it would take years. I wish a portion or whole of the train track was repurposed into a bike trail to connect with the NCR trail. I ride my bike by road to the Shrewsbury Park and Ride and it’s a bit dangerous. This train track runs through it and would be so much safer to bike on. Regardless, the Stewartstown Railroad is wonderfully preserved and is a fun experience, even though it is a bit short.

We had such a great time on the villains express train! The lady’s did such a fabulous job with the witch sisters characters! They did such a wonderful job I felt like I was the movie! Sadly the train ride is only about 2 miles long but that is because the rest of the tracks are in need of repair and is being done by volunteers. They do have work days if you want to volunteer. The crew is very friendly and enthusiastic! I will definitely be back and I fully recommend them and please consider donating or volunteering if you can! You can can support by riding! I know this may sound like I am being paid for this review but I am not. I am just a train lover that’s wants to see them bring this railroad back to life! So much potential here!

We loved our visit to Stewartstown railroad which included a train ride as well as a tour of the historic train station. The volunteers were extremely knowledgeable, friendly, and eager to share the history of the railroad company, as well as other historical railroad facts and anecdotes. A great family day trip for anyone from the age of 5 to 95!
